Meatball Variations With Global Flavors

Foodie By Foodie Published March 4, 2026
Share
SHARE

Meatballs are a versatile dish that can be adapted to cuisines from around the world. From Italian classics to Asian-inspired bites, meatballs offer endless opportunities for flavor experimentation. They can be served as appetizers, main courses, or even in sandwiches, making them suitable for everyday meals or special occasions. Using a variety of meats, spices, and sauces allows you to explore global flavors while keeping preparation simple. This guide provides recipes for several international meatball styles, showing how traditional techniques and local ingredients can transform this humble dish into a culinary adventure.

Italian-Style Beef and Parmesan Meatballs

Classic Italian meatballs are rich, tender, and perfect for pairing with pasta or tomato sauce.

Ingredients:

  • 500g ground beef
  • 50g Parmesan cheese, grated
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 egg
  • 50g breadcrumbs
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 400ml tomato sauce for serving

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 200°C and line a baking tray with parchment paper.
  2. In a large bowl, combine ground beef, Parmesan, onion, garlic, egg, breadcrumbs, parsley, salt, and pepper. Mix until just combined.
  3. Shape mixture into 12–15 meatballs and place on the tray.
  4. Bake for 15–20 minutes until golden and cooked through.
  5. Serve hot with tomato sauce and pasta or bread.

Swedish Meatballs

These meatballs are tender, creamy, and lightly spiced with nutmeg and allspice, typically served with a rich gravy.

Ingredients:

  • 500g ground beef and pork mixture
  • 1 small onion, grated
  • 50g breadcrumbs
  • 1 egg
  • ½ te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• ½ teaspoon ground allspice
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 200ml beef stock
  • 100ml cream

Instructions:

  1. Preheat a skillet over medium heat with a little oil.
  2. Mix ground meat, onion, breadcrumbs, egg, nutmeg, allspice, salt, and pepper. Shape into small balls.
  3. Brown meatballs in batches until cooked through, then remove and set aside.
  4. Add beef stock and cream to the pan, simmer until thickened, and return meatballs to the sauce.
  5. Serve with mashed potatoes or lingonberry jam.

Middle Eastern Lamb Meatballs with Tahini Sauce

These lamb meatballs are aromatic with spices and pair perfectly with a creamy tahini sauce.

Ingredients:

  • 500g ground lamb
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on ground coriander
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t and black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ped

Tahini Sauce:

  • 3 tablespoons tahini
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 garlic clove, minced
  • Water to thin
  • Salt to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 200°C and line a baking tray with parchment paper.
  2. Mix lamb, onion, garlic, cumin, coriander, paprika, parsley, salt, and pepper. Shape into small meatballs.
  3. Bake for 15–20 minutes until cooked through.
  4. Mix tahini, lemon juice, garlic, and water to a smooth, pourable consistency.
  5. Serve meatballs drizzled with tahini sauce and accompanied by flatbread or salad.

Asian-Style Chicken Meatballs

These light chicken meatballs are flavored with ginger, soy, and sesame for a delicious umami taste.

Ingredients:

  • 500g ground chicken
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 teaspoon fresh ginger, grated
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• 2 tablespoons breadcrumbs
  • 1 egg
  • 1 spring onion, finely chopped

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 200°C and line a baking tray with parchment paper.
  2. Combine chicken, garlic, ginger, soy sauce, sesame oil, breadcrumbs, egg, and spring onion. Mix gently and form into meatballs.
  3. Bake for 15–20 minutes until golden and cooked through.
  4. Serve with steamed rice or a soy-ginger dipping sauce.

Mexican-Inspired Beef and Chorizo Meatballs

Spicy and smoky, these meatballs are full of flavor and pair well with tomato-based sauces or tacos.

Ingredients:

  • 250g ground beef
  • 250g chorizo, finely chopped
  • 1 small onion, chopped
  • 1 garlic clove, minced
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• Salt and black pepper
  • 400ml tomato sauce for serving

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 200°C and line a baking tray with parchment paper.
  2. Mix beef, chorizo, onion, garlic, paprika, cumin, salt, and pepper. Shape into small meatballs.
  3. Bake for 15–20 minutes until cooked through and slightly crispy.
  4. Serve with warm tortillas, rice, or directly in tomato sauce as a hearty dish.

Meatballs are a global comfort food that can be adapted to countless flavors and cuisines. From creamy Swedish meatballs to spicy Mexican bites, each variation brings unique spices, textures, and serving styles to your table. Making meatballs at home allows for freshness, creativity, and control over ingredients, while pairing them with sauces or accompaniments enhances their taste. Experimenting with global flavors introduces new culinary experiences and keeps meals exciting. By mastering these recipes, you can enjoy delicious, culturally inspired meatballs any day of the week.
